your mind Researchers have sequenced the genome of Alexander Fleming’s penicillin mold for the first time and compared it to later versions.

The resulting genome was compared to the previously published genomes of two industrial strains of Penicillium used later in the US. When you tell me you're in love In both the UK and US strains, the regulatory genes had the same genetic code, but the US strains had more copies of the regulatory genes, helping those strains produce more penicillin.

The team re-grew Fleming’s original Penicillium from a frozen sample kept at the culture collection at CABI and extracted the DNA for sequencing.

Some bacteria produce enzymes that break down the beta-lactam ring, called beta-lactamases, which make the bacteria resistant to penicillin. The term "penicillin" was used originally for benzylpenicillin, penicillin G. Currently, "Penicillin" is used as a generic term for antibiotics that contain the beta lactam unit in the chemical structure.
